Profiles of the Richest Women Leaders

Family Wealth and Enterprise

Many of the richest women build their positions on multigenerational family enterprises, combining inherited capital with modern governance. This structure often provides stability, long-term vision, and access to global networks that accelerate expansion.

Tech, Retail, and Industrial Influence

Wealth accumulation among top women leaders spans technology shareholders, retail magnates, and industrial titans. Their strategic decisions in capital allocation, mergers, and innovation directly affect sector growth and employment trends across continents.

Regional Patterns in Billionaire Populations

Regional economies shape the concentration of female billionaires, with North America, Europe, and Asia leading in both count and sector diversity. Policy environments, market openness, and education access influence who can scale ventures to billionaire status.

Sector Shifts Over the Past Decade

The last decade has seen technology and e-commerce rise as primary wealth engines, while traditional sectors like real estate and manufacturing adapt. Women leaders have leveraged digital transformation to enter and disrupt industries previously dominated by men.

Economic Impact and Philanthropy

Job Creation and Innovation Drivers

By investing in research, infrastructure, and talent, the richest women generate significant employment and technological breakthroughs. Their companies often become anchors in regional economies, supporting small businesses and supply chains.

Strategic Giving and Social Initiatives

Philanthropy among top women billionaires targets education, health equity, climate action, and economic inclusion. Directed giving and impact investing aim to solve systemic challenges while improving public access to essential services and opportunity.

Market Valuation and Investment Strategies

Equity Stakes and Portfolio Diversification

Wealth is frequently tied to publicly traded shares, private holdings, and real assets, requiring sophisticated risk management. Diversification across geographies, currencies, and asset classes helps preserve value through economic cycles.

Governance and Long-Term Wealth Preservation

Family offices and professional trustees play a critical role in overseeing vast resources, ensuring compliance, and planning for succession. Transparent governance strengthens stakeholder trust and supports sustainable wealth growth.

    How is the net worth of the richest women calculated and updated?

    Net worth is estimated using publicly traded stock values, private company valuations, real estate, and other assets, then adjusted for debt. Rankings are updated periodically in response to market movements, new business launches, and valuation changes.

    What industries do the top women billionaires typically come from?

    Top women billionaires are often found in retail, technology, consumer goods, finance, and healthcare, reflecting both historical family industries and new digital-era opportunities.

    Can policy changes significantly alter the net worth rankings of these women?

    Tax reforms, antitrust actions, trade policy, and regulatory shifts can affect corporate profits and valuations, directly influencing personal net worth and sector competitiveness.

    What role do family offices play in managing extreme wealth for these leaders?

    Family offices coordinate investment strategy, risk management, philanthropy, and succession planning, helping to preserve and grow wealth across generations while aligning with family values.
